Common Maintenance Mistakes to Avoid

Now, let’s talk about some common mistakes manufacturers often make in their maintenance practices.

  1. Skipping Regular Inspections: Regular inspections can catch small issues before they turn into major problems. For instance, failing to check coolant levels or not cleaning the machine parts can lead to overheating, resulting in costly repairs and downtime.

  2. Ignoring Manufacturer Guidelines: Every CNC lathe comes with a set of manufacturer guidelines for maintenance. Skipping these can lead to ineffective maintenance strategies. For example, if the guidance indicates specific lubrication requirements, not adhering to them may cause increased wear and tear on your machine.

  3. Delayed Repairs: Waiting too long to fix minor issues can cause major breakdowns. For instance, if you notice a slight vibration in your lathe, it’s essential to investigate immediately, as it could signal misalignment or worn bearings.

Predictive Maintenance: By utilizing sensors and IoT technology, predictive maintenance allows manufacturers to monitor machine performance in real time. This technology can analyze data to predict issues before they occur, saving time and money. Imagine receiving an alert on your phone about a potential failure before it disrupts your production line!

Remote Monitoring: With remote monitoring systems, you can keep track of your CNC lathe’s health from anywhere. This feature not only boosts convenience but also allows for timely decision-making. If a sensor indicates a drop in performance, you can address it before it escalates into a costly breakdown.
